Overview
The LTC2221IUP#PBF is a high-performance, 12-bit analog-to-digital converter (ADC) manufactured by Analog Devices Inc. This device is part of the Linear Technology product line, which is now integrated into Analog Devices. The LTC2221 is designed for high-speed and low-power applications, making it suitable for a variety of industrial, medical, and communication systems.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Value |
---|---|
Resolution | 12 bits |
Number of Inputs | 1 |
Architecture | Pipelined |
Sample Rate | Up to 80 MSPS |
Power Consumption | Typically 240 mW at 80 MSPS |
Supply Voltage | 1.8V to 3.3V |
Package Type | 64-QFN (9x9 mm) |
Operating Temperature Range | -40°C to 85°C |
Key Features
- High-speed operation up to 80 MSPS
- Low power consumption, typically 240 mW at 80 MSPS
- High dynamic performance with SNR of up to 73.5 dBFS and SFDR of up to 90 dBFS
- Support for both single-ended and differential analog input
- Internal reference and optional external reference input
- CMOS or LVDS digital output options
